The Caretaker Chairman of Okpokwu Local Government Area of Benue State, Prince George Adah narrowly escaped death few days ago as suspected hired assassins almost beat him to death at the APC secretariat in Makurdi.

It was gathered that Hon. Adah had visited the state capital to brief the Acting Governor, Engr. Benson Abounu on the communal clash that broke out in the council area, which left 5 persons dead a few weeks back.


An Abuja-based journalist, Yemi Itodo reports that on reaching Makurdi, Adah could not see the Acting Governor who was said to be busy at the time.


Adah was, however, advised to report to the deputy Speaker, Hon. James Okefe, who incidentally hails from the same Okpokwu LGA, however his efforts to see Okefe were unsuccessful.
Narrating his ordeal, Adah said, “On reaching the Kanshio area at the outskirt of the town, I got a call from Hon. Godwin Idoko, Special Adviser to the Governor on Ethics and Value Orientation, that the deputy Speaker was ready to see me.


“We made U-turn to Makurdi town and when we got there, Hon. Idoko asked us to sit with him at the joint within the party secretariat and discuss before the arrival of the deputy Speaker.

“It was in that process that I saw two (2) fierce looking men moving towards our direction, and before I could know what was going on, one of them took the bottle filled with beer and hit my head, while the other one rushed me.


“The gush of the blood oozed around my face as I struggled to get up and run for my life. As fate would have it, it was like they heard a sound of siren coming towards our area and I could feel their hands off me.

“And then, there was an usual strength that engulfed me and I started running, even though I didn’t know the direction I was running towards.


“I was running without my sandals, without my phones and car keys. I didn’t even know what would become of my party chairman and those other 2 innocent guys.

“On a lonely road, I saw a motorcycle rider who took me to the police station where I narrated my ordeal. I was later taken to the hospital by the police.

“Thereafter, the police took me to the residence of Hon. Idoko and when he refused to open the gate, the police threatened to declare war on him; when he eventually opened the gate, he said my car was with a Personal Assistant to the deputy Speaker. How could someone who was not at the scene of the incident be in possession of my car? Hon. Idoko could not answer the questions from the police,” he narrated.
When asked if he knew that the council Chairman was attacked when he came to see him in Makurdi, the deputy Speaker said he was busy and could not talk further on the matter.
